Culture and nature lovers will definitely adore Ubud. This place is where you can find an abundance of lush rice fields, traditional villages, and yoga retreats. The absolute must-visit spot in Ubud would be the UNESCO-recognized Tegalalang Rice Terrace because of its breathtaking series of cascading rice fields. This UNESCO World Heritage site is very popular during both sunrise and sunset.

The Mount Batur Sunrise Trek is one of Bali’s most sought-after experiences. This is a unique experience you can have only in Kintamani. It offers you an unforgettable sunrise hike accompanied by the panoramic views of Lake Batur. Other than the infamous sunrise trek, you must also visit various cafés and hot springs nearby.

Nusa Penida Island has some of the most Instagram-famous spots such as Kelingking Beach and Angel’s Billabong. This island is a top day-trip destination in Bali where you can enjoy various activities for a one full day. If you’re visiting this island, make sure to try its popular snorkeling experience with manta rays.

Uluwatu is known for its dramatic cliffs, surfing waves, and golden sunsets. This area has an abundance of breathtaking beaches such as Suluban Beach, Melasti Beach, and Nyang-Nyang Beach. The best time to visit here is around before the sun sets as it has one of the most beautiful sunset views in Bali.

Visit the iconic Lempuyang temple for a truly unique photography spot. It is among the most photographed spots in Bali with Mount Agung framed in its split gates.

For those looking for trendy areas with beach clubs, surfing, shopping, and dining, visit Seminyak or Canggu. Seminyak is a mix tourist residential area with high-end stores, spas, and resorts. The other one, Canggu, is where you can find various vegan cafes, beach bars, and boutiques. Both of these areas are popular among younger international travelers.

Practical Tips for Visiting Bali Tourist Attractions

  1. Best Times to Visit

Bali’s dry season, which generally runs from April to October, is considered the best time to visit. You can expect sunny days, lower humidity, and minimal rainfall that makes it perfect for all summer activities.

  1. What to Pack

When you have chosen to visit Bali during the dry season, make sure to pack light clothing and comfortable shoes. Additionally, don’t forget to bring your camera to immortalize your moments on the island.

  1. Suggested Routes

Different parts of Bali offer different tourist experiences. If you’re especially looking for cultural experiences and beaches, visit Southern Bali. And if you’re seeking natural adventures, take the Northern/Eastern Bali route.
